KATHMANDU, Feb 15: The British College has been providing internationally recognized qualifications awarded by the University of the West of England (UWE) and Leeds Beckett University (LBU).

Rajan Kandel, the college's chief executer officer and chairman of Britain Nepal Chambers of Commerce, briefly talked with Repbulica following the launch of their MBA (Executive) program at the British College.

The British College has been providing internationally recognized degrees since its establishment. How important in your views are foreign degrees?

They are very important. Degrees awarded by domestic universities are hardly useful beyond the country's borders. Our internationally recognized qualifications make it easier for students to study and get work abroad. Even if our students choose to work or study within the country, they would be at an advantage over other students because of their skills and qualifications.

How is the recently launched MBA program different from others?

We launched the MBA (Executive) program a week ago. As against other normal MBA programs, only those who have minimum two years of work experience in executive positions can enroll into the program. The program will further hone their management skills and expose them to today's globalized markets through our "local to global" approach. We are currently the only institute that provides this course in Nepal.

How is the college taking "local to global" approach?

Our main objective has been to produce globally competent human resources. To help us accomplish that we have international faculty members teaching latest curriculum. Our students get to attend regular guest lectures and speeches from scholars from the UK and other countries as well as from major companies in Nepal. Students gain valuable multi-cultural experience, which forms an essential part of their learning process. We believe our "local to global" approach has been making a huge difference on our students overall development.
